In a previous paper, the authors presented the identification method of locations and force histories of point impacts on laminated composite flat plates by using the measured values of acceleration. This paper deals with an attempt to extend the method so as to apply to identification of point impacts on laminated composite curved panels. Numerical identification results are obtained for the single point impact and double point impacts on cross-ply laminated composite curved panels. The validity of the identification method to laminated composite curved panels is verified by comparing the identification results with exact ones. In addition, when the number of point impacts is unknown, a method to decide the identification results is proposed. Several numerical examples are considered to ascertain the validity of the proposed method.
